在处理文档表格数据时,重复的数据往往会让我们的工作变得复杂和繁琐。学会如何有效地去除重复数据,是提高工作效率和数据准确性的关键。下面,我将详细介绍几种轻松学会文档表格去重的方法,帮助你告别重复数据的烦恼。
了解重复数据
首先,我们需要明确什么是重复数据。在文档表格中,重复数据通常指的是在行或列中完全相同的数据记录。这些重复的数据可能源于输入错误、数据同步问题或者数据导入时的错误。
去重方法概述
1. 手动去重
对于数据量较小的表格,手动去重是一个简单直接的方法。你可以通过以下步骤进行:
- 打开表格,选中所有数据。
- 使用表格软件(如Microsoft Excel或Google Sheets)的“删除重复项”功能。
- 选择要检查重复的列,点击“确定”进行去重。
2. 使用编程语言
如果你熟悉Python等编程语言,可以使用Pandas库来处理大型数据集的去重问题。以下是一个简单的Python代码示例:
import pandas as pd
# 读取数据
data = pd.read_csv('your_data.csv')
# 去重
unique_data = data.drop_duplicates()
# 保存结果
unique_data.to_csv('unique_data.csv', index=False)
3. 利用表格软件的高级功能
一些高级表格软件提供了更强大的去重工具,例如:
- Microsoft Excel:使用“数据”选项卡中的“高级”功能,可以选择“删除重复项”。
- Google Sheets:在“数据”菜单中,选择“删除重复项”功能。
4. 第三方工具和软件
市面上也有一些专门的数据清洗工具,如Alteryx、Trifacta等,它们提供了图形化界面和丰富的功能,可以帮助你更高效地处理数据去重。
实战案例
假设我们有一个包含姓名、年龄和邮箱的表格,其中存在重复的记录。以下是如何使用Pandas进行去重的具体步骤:
- 导入Pandas库。
- 读取数据。
- 使用
drop_duplicates()方法去重。 - 检查去重后的结果。
import pandas as pd
# 读取数据
data = pd.read_csv('contact_info.csv')
# 去重
unique_contacts = data.drop_duplicates(subset=['姓名', '年龄', '邮箱'])
# 查看去重后的数据
print(unique_contacts)
总结
通过上述方法,你可以轻松地去除文档表格中的重复数据。无论数据量大小,选择合适的方法都能帮助你提高工作效率,确保数据的准确性。记住,定期清理数据是维护良好数据管理习惯的重要一环。
